Lovlina Borgohain Secures India's First Medal at the 2026 Commonwealth Games

¨     Indian boxer Lovlina Borgohain secured India's first medal at the Commonwealth Games 2026 in Glasgow, Scotland, even before the opening ceremony.

¨     She is assured of at least a bronze medal in the women's 75 kg boxing event after receiving a bye into the semifinals.

¨     Under the Commonwealth Games boxing format, both losing semifinalists receive bronze medals.

¨     Reaching the semifinals guarantees a medal, regardless of the semifinal result.

¨     Lovlina Borgohain is an Olympic medallist from India.

¨     She competes in the women's 75 kg weight category.

¨     She is scheduled to begin her campaign in the semifinals on 31 July 2026.

¨     India has sent a 124-member contingent to the Commonwealth Games 2026.

¨     The Indian contingent is participating in 10 sports.

¨     The Glasgow 2026 programme is smaller than several previous editions of the Commonwealth Games.

¨     The Commonwealth Games 2026 are being held in Glasgow, Scotland, from 23 July to 2 August 2026.
